About Middleton

Middleton commands a rugged, upland character where the wind carries the sharp, clean scent of high moorland grit. It lies 4.2 miles east-south-east of Earby (from Earby: bearing 121°T, OS grid SD 966 432), and is situated west of Cowling village. The landscape around Middleton rises in sudden, muscular swells, defined by the proximity of Knoll Hill to the west and the brooding presence of Cinder Hill just a short walk to the east. Water defines the local geography, as the clear, insistent rush of Ickornshaw Beck traces the eastern boundary with a cold, metallic brightness.
